The New England Patriots held their seventh organized team activity (OTA) of the spring, emphasizing player attendance and involvement. Notably, wide receiver Stefon Diggs returned, showing positive signs in his ACL recovery. While Drake Maye delivered an improved performance, the session was marred by injuries to linebacker Jahlani Tavai and guard Wes Schweitzer. Overall, the practice illustrated the team's ongoing development and challenges as they prepare for the upcoming season amidst notable player absences and limited participation from others.
